Global Concrete Surface Retarders Market: Overview

Concrete surface retarders are chemical agents applied to freshly poured concrete to slow down the setting process of the top surface layer. This allows the underlying concrete to cure normally while the surface remains workable for a longer period.

The retarder creates a textured or exposed aggregate finish by delaying surface hardening, which can then be removed to achieve the desired look or function. These products are widely used in decorative concrete applications, construction of slip-resistant surfaces, and preparation for bonding new layers to the existing surface.

Segmentation Insights by Type

Based on Type, the global concrete surface retarders market is divided into water-based and solvent-based.

The Water-based Concrete Surface Retarders segment is gaining traction due to the global push for sustainable and environmentally friendly construction practices. Water-based concrete surface retarders are co-friendly and low-VOC products favored for decorative and architectural applications in sustainable construction projects. Growth is driven by environmental regulations and increasing demand for green building materials. Challenges include performance limitations in extreme conditions.

However, Solvent-based Surface Retarders continue to be preferred for industrial and infrastructure applications where performance under extreme conditions is critical. Solvent-based concrete surface retarders are high-performance solutions suitable for industrial, infrastructure, and heavy-duty applications. Growth is fueled by demand for durable products in challenging environments. Challenges include environmental and health concerns and competition from sustainable alternatives.

Segmentation Insights by Application

On the basis of Application, the global concrete surface retarders market is bifurcated into residential and commercial building.

The Commercial Building Application segment is the larger contributor to the market in terms of value. In the Commercial Building segment, concrete surface retarders are widely used for creating durable, slip-resistant, and visually appealing finishes in high-traffic areas. These applications are common in retail spaces, office complexes, hotels, and public infrastructure projects, where both aesthetics and functionality are important.

However, the Residential Application segment is growing rapidly, driven by increasing consumer interest in decorative and functional concrete surfaces for homes. In the Residential segment, concrete surface retarders are primarily used to enhance the aesthetics of driveways, patios, walkways, and other decorative concrete features. These applications focus on creating visually appealing surfaces that complement residential environments while also improving durability and slip resistance.
